CC -!- CATALYTIC ACTIVITY:
CC Reaction=Hydrolysis of terminal, non-reducing alpha-D-galactose
CC residues in alpha-D-galactosides, including galactose
CC oligosaccharides, galactomannans and galactolipids.; EC=3.2.1.22;
CC Evidence={ECO:0000256|ARBA:ARBA00001255};
